Transaction 05f521fabc3a5692ab48f4d5477f3e27300d46c11684679c1d843aae8f0d2794
2 Input
1 Outputs
- 05f521fabc3a5692ab48f4d5477f3e27300d46c11684679c1d843aae8f0d2794:0
value 499621
address 16WGXWiGhXN23xYkteX33qyvowvcPvme2Y